  • Patent number: 11933674
    Abstract: Systems and methods are provided for logging temperatures of food products using a temperature assembly including a housing and one or more temperature sensors, e.g., an infrared sensor for surface temperatures and an elongate probe for acquiring a temperature within a food product, and a mobile electronic device including a camera, a communication interface for communicating with the temperature assembly, a processor configured to acquire a temperature reading from the temperature assembly and an image from the camera when the temperature reading is acquired, and memory for storing the temperature reading and image.
    Type: Grant
    Filed: February 28, 2023
    Date of Patent: March 19, 2024
    Assignee: Avery Dennison Retail Information Services LLC
    Inventor: Daniel Riscalla
  • Patent number: 11901049
    Abstract: A system and method for acquiring, compiling and displaying data indicative of healthcare data workflow within an integrated healthcare enterprise simplifies the monitoring and identification of inefficiencies such as bottlenecks in the enterprise. Information gathered from enterprise system components and data files are used to measure individual component performance. System alerts and messaging capabilities allow an enterprise administrator to remedy potential bottlenecks before problems arise. Remedial measures may be programmed into the system to automatically remedy inefficiencies as they are identified.
    Type: Grant
    Filed: June 1, 2022
    Date of Patent: February 13, 2024
    Assignee: Compressus, Inc.
    Inventors: Albert Hernandez, Susan Pede, Joel Rosenfield, Daniel Riscalla, Laszlo R. Gasztonyi, Ronald G. Gesell

  • Patent number: 10726386
    Abstract: Systems and methods are provided for conducting inventories using an electronic device. For example, the systems and methods herein may facilitate conducting inventories, e.g., for inventorying food products and/or other supplies for a restaurant. Such systems and methods may involve using an electronic device, such as a wireless and/or mobile devices, e.g., a smart cellular telephone, a tablet computer, and the like. In addition, the electronic device may be included in a system that records inventories, deliveries, and the like, and compares them to previous inventories, sales, and the like, e.g. to project future orders for supplies, to identify losses, such as waste or theft, and the like.
    Type: Grant
    Filed: August 3, 2015
    Date of Patent: July 28, 2020
    Inventor: Daniel Riscalla

  • Patent number: 8888492
    Abstract: Systems and methods are provided for ordering prepared food products via a network using an electronic device. A menu of available prepared food products may be presented on a display, and one of the prepared food products may be selected using an interface of the device. A menu of bread items available may be presented including visual representations of each available bread item. One of the bread items may be selected, whereupon a visual representation of the selected bread may be presented. One or more ingredients may be selected using the interface, whereupon visual representations of the ingredients are superimposed on the visual representation of the selected bread item. The systems and methods may provide an enhanced visual experience similar to ordering the product in person and watching the product being made.
    Type: Grant
    Filed: November 21, 2011
    Date of Patent: November 18, 2014
    Inventor: Daniel Riscalla

  • Publication number: 20070121592
    Abstract: The invention provides marketing a telephone service that has an adapter or dongle that is functionally interposed between a telephone and a telephone utility line. The adapter is programmed to receive a voice signal and telephone number transmitted by the telephone. Based on the telephone number, the adapter determines whether to (i) pass the telephone number through to the utility line, or (ii) pass a different access number through to the utility line. A first server then receives voice signal through the telephone utility line, and to send the voice signal as a series of packets through a packet switched network to a second server. The second server is programmed to transmit and receive the voice signal to a second telephone via another telephone utility line. The service is based on a flat-fee subscription.
    Type: Application
    Filed: December 4, 2006
    Publication date: May 31, 2007
    Inventors: Sean Ryan, Daniel Riscalla
